Output 84ba96f2662c61158d774700cf2d5677bccf8020657bc47f392dd7cb48c373dc:1

value
538434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5db59248b3898744835e380559027d43a7183ae0 OP_EQUAL
address
3AEWHBq9JfZZYeP2fB83sPJTApiaTD4Exo
transaction
84ba96f2662c61158d774700cf2d5677bccf8020657bc47f392dd7cb48c373dc
spent
true